Comprehending Shipping Containers
Shipping containers come in different sizes and types, created to fulfill various needs. Here are the most common types you will find in the market:
Container TypeDescriptionDimensions (L x W x H)Standard DryThe most common type for basic cargo.20' x 8' x 8.5'High Cube DryTaller than standard containers for more space.40' x 8' x 9.5'RefrigeratedInsulated containers with refrigeration units for disposable items.40' x 8' x 9.5'Open TopGeared up with a removable tarpaulin cover for large cargo.20' x 8' x 8.5'Flat Rack Containers RackFlat platform, frequently used for heavy or oversized loads.40' x 8' x 2.5'ISO TankRound tanks created for transferring liquids.20' x 8' x 8.5'Common Uses for Shipping Containers
Shipping containers have actually found a large selection of applications, including however not restricted to:
Storage Solutions: Businesses and people make use of shipping containers for saving products, devices, or tools.
Residential Homes: Creative architects and house owners are repurposing shipping containers into modern, stylish homes.
Mobile Offices: Businesses often convert containers into portable workplace, supplying a useful service for construction sites and remote work places.
Retail Spaces: Many start-ups and established brands have turned to shipping containers as pop-up retail stores, providing a distinct shopping experience.
Workshops and Studios: Artists and artisans have actually discovered Shipping Container Business containers ideal for establishing workshops, studios, or hobby spaces.
What to Consider When Buying a Shipping Container
When considering buying a shipping container, purchasers need to assess numerous factors:
1. Purpose of Use
Different usages need different types of containers. Assess what you need the container for, whether it's for storage, living area, or another purpose.
2. New vs. Used Containers
New Containers: These containers remain in beautiful condition and without rust or damages. They are normally more pricey but can serve longer without repairs.
Used Containers: Often more budget friendly, used containers may show signs of wear and tear, which might affect their functionality. It's vital to check them for structural integrity.
3. Container Size
Containers usually can be found in 20-foot and 40-foot lengths, however other sizes exist. Select a size that meets your capacity needs without excess space.
4. Delivery Logistics
Consider how you will transport the container to your area. Some suppliers offer delivery services, while others might need you to pick it up.
5. Regional Regulations
Before buying a container, it's vital to examine local zoning laws and building regulations, particularly if you prepare to transform it for living or business usage.
6. Cost
Prices for shipping containers can vary based upon size, condition, and location. Here's a basic cost variety based on the kind of container:

You can discover shipping containers at various providers, both online and in your area. Major sites consist of ContainerExchange, eBay, and regional classifieds. Additionally, shipping companies frequently sell their retired containers.
2. How much does a shipping container weigh?
The weight of a container differs based upon size and type, however a standard 20-foot dry container generally weighs around 4,800 pounds (2,200 kg), while a 40-foot container can weigh around 8,000 pounds (3,600 kg).
3. How long do shipping containers last?
With proper maintenance, shipping containers can last for 25 years or more. Elements that impact durability include exposure to weather, quality of materials, and how they are used.
4. What is the difference between weatherproof and leak-proof containers?
Weatherproof containers are built to resist the aspects, while water tight containers are particularly designed to avoid water intrusion. For storage functions, it is necessary to consider the kind of security required.
5. Can I modify a shipping container?
Yes, numerous individuals customize Shipping Container Manufacturers containers for special usages. Modifications might include adding windows, doors, insulation, and electrical electrical wiring, among other changes.
